TL;DR · Senior Silicon Design Engineer, Hardware-Software Co-Design, GPU Compute and AI Compilers & Runtimes

The AMD AI Group seeks a Senior Silicon Design Engineer to co-design the hardware-software interface for AMD Instinct™ GPUs, working closely with hardware architects to model and evaluate how GPU microarchitecture interacts with AI frameworks and the ROCm™ software stack. Day-to-day responsibilities include building performance and power models that connect architectural decisions to real workload behavior, evaluating proposed hardware features against AI training and inference targets, and optimizing GPU kernels and compiler passes for AMD GPUs. The role involves deep collaboration across the Linux kernel DRM/GEM layer, ROCm™ runtime, IREE compiler, and AI frameworks like PyTorch and Triton, requiring expertise in C/C++, Python, CUDA/HIP, and knowledge of modern AI model architectures. Ideal candidates have 5+ years of industry experience at the hardware-software boundary, strong computer architecture skills, and proficiency with AMD Instinct GPU architectures and ROCm™ stack.
